
Crisp and tangy, pickled napa cabbage offers a refreshing crunch and a burst of flavor that brightens dishes. Its vibrant color and acidity make it a lively addition to any meal.
Where it comes from
A staple in East Asian cuisines, pickled napa cabbage has a long history of preservation methods, often served alongside rice and noodles to complement richer flavors.
In the kitchen
Used as a condiment or side dish, pickled napa cabbage adds acidity and texture to stir-fries, soups, and rice dishes, enhancing the overall balance of flavors.
